Отслеживание покупок с помощью функционального пикселя onClick: подробное руководство

В сегодняшней цифровой среде отслеживание покупок на веб-сайтах электронной коммерции имеет решающее значение для компаний, позволяющих понимать поведение клиентов, оптимизировать маркетинговые кампании и стимулировать продажи. Одним из эффективных методов отслеживания покупок является использование функционального пикселя onClick. В этой статье мы рассмотрим различные методы реализации отслеживания покупок с помощью функций onClick, попутно предоставляя вам практические примеры кода.

Метод 1. Встроенный атрибут onClick.
Один из самых простых способов отслеживания покупок с помощью функционального пикселя onClick — использование встроенного атрибута onClick в элементе HTML. Допустим, у вас есть кнопка «Купить сейчас». Вы можете добавить атрибут onClick к элементу кнопки и вызвать функцию JavaScript, которая запускает код отслеживания пикселей. Вот пример:

<button onClick="trackPurchase()">Buy Now</button>
<script>
  function trackPurchase() {
    // Pixel tracking code goes here
    // This code will be executed when the button is clicked
  }
</script>

Метод 2: прослушиватель событий.
Другой подход – добавить прослушиватель событий к нужному элементу, например кнопке или ссылке, с помощью JavaScript. Этот метод обеспечивает большую гибкость и позволяет отделить логику отслеживания от разметки HTML. Вот пример:

<button id="buyButton">Buy Now</button>
<script>
  const buyButton = document.getElementById('buyButton');
  buyButton.addEventListener('click', trackPurchase);
  function trackPurchase() {
    // Pixel tracking code goes here
    // This code will be executed when the button is clicked
  }
</script>
<button onClick="gtag('event', 'purchase', { 'transaction_id': '1234', 'value': '49.99' });">Buy Now</button>

Метод 4: индивидуальные решения для отслеживания.
Если у вас есть собственная система отслеживания, вы можете адаптировать функциональный пиксель onClick для отправки данных о покупках на свой сервер или в стороннюю службу отслеживания. Вы можете сделать запрос AJAX или использовать другие методы для отправки соответствующей информации о покупке. Вот упрощенный пример использования jQuery:

<button id="buyButton">Buy Now</button>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script>
  $('#buyButton').click(function() {
    $.ajax({
      url: '/track-purchase',
      method: 'POST',
      data: { product_id: '1234', price: '49.99' },
      success: function(response) {
        // Handle the response
      }
    });
  });
</script>

Отслеживание покупок с помощью функционального пикселя onClick – это эффективный способ получить ценную информацию о покупательском поведении ваших клиентов. В этой статье мы рассмотрели несколько методов, в том числе использование встроенных атрибутов onClick, прослушивателей событий, Google Analytics с gtag.js и пользовательских решений для отслеживания. Внедрив эти методы, вы сможете лучше понять модели покупок ваших клиентов и соответствующим образом оптимизировать свои маркетинговые усилия.